Optimization of long-range PCR protocol to prepare filaggrin exon 3 libraries for PacBio long-read sequencing
Chiara Mareso,Elena Albion,William Cozza,Benedetta Tanzi,S. Cecchin,Paolo Gisondi,S Michelini,Francesco Bellinato,S Michelini,Silvia Michelini,Matteo Bertelli,Giuseppe Marceddu +11 more
TL;DR: In this paper , a 2-step long-range PCR protocol was used to generate 13-kb amplicons covering the whole filaggrin exon 3 sequence, which can be used for identification of LoF variants that are causative of the patients' disorders.

Microbiome characterization of alpine water springs for human consumption reveals site- and usage-specific microbial signatures
Renato Pedron,Alfonso Esposito,William Cozza,Massimo Paolazzi,M. Cristofolini,Nicola Segata,Olivier Jousson +6 more
TL;DR: In this article , the authors used 16S rRNA high throughput sequencing to characterize the microbiome of 38 water springs in Trentino (Northern Italy) for two consecutive years in order to gain precious insights on the microbiome composition of these unexplored yet hardly exploited environments.
